Former President Jimmy Carter met with top leader of the Hamas. He met with Khaled Meshaal, leader of the terrorist organization to discuss Hamas’ involvement with the peace that Carter is trying to facilitate in the Middle East . Carter was advised against the visit by both Isreali government and the Bush Administration. Carter did stress that he was not there to serve as a mediator but more of a “communicator” in the process.
